As Dora Neared Mainland--Hurricane Dora is shown as the storm neared the U.S. mainland early today in this picture released by NASA Goddard Space Flight Center in Washington today. The picture was sent from the Nimbus satellite by infra-red transmission at 1:27 a.m., EDT. Chesapeake and Delaware Bays are shown as dark area in upper right above the storm.
